I'm not sure about the "green party" thing, but I did understand that Mercedes-Benz, BMW, Audi and some manufactures were told (or all agreed) to limit their cars to 155MPH -- don't know how they came up with that number. When this went into effect the Lexus LS400 (1995 model - 1999 model) was limited at 156MPH, 1MPH faster than the competitors (I know you guys don't want to hear that).
